Uighur activist should not be allowed to visit Taiwan: minister
2009-12-30
Premier Wu Den-yih (left) and Minister of the
Interior Jiang Yi-huah speak during a question
and answer session at the legislature in Taipei
Friday. Jiang recommended Taiwan should not
permit Uighur activist Rebiya Kadeer to visit
because her Uighur World Congress is closely
associated with a terrorist group. Wu supported
his position.
